I cut and sleeved mine (internally) with no problems. Suprisingly when I cut then the inside was spotless and I turned up a sleeve to fit inside and
welded them. Mark a line along the shaft before cutting to keep it in balance.
Done quite a few full throttle standing starts and high speed runs with ho problems so far.
